DNS解析原理简介有哪些常见问题需要注意

时间:2025-12-07 分类:电脑硬件

DNS(域名系统)作为互联网的基础设施之一,起着将人类友好的域名转换为机器可读的IP地址的重要角色。尽管DNS的工作机制相对简单,但在实际应用中,DNS解析的效率、稳定性以及安全性常常成为用户和管理员需要关注的焦点。了解DNS解析原理以及常见问题十分重要。

DNS解析原理简介有哪些常见问题需要注意

DNS解析的基本过程包括多个步骤,用户发起请求后,DNS服务器通过多个查询环节找出对应的IP地址。当一个域名被请求时,首先在本地缓存中查找匹配,如果未找到,查询将发送到配置的DNS服务器。若该服务器没有相应的记录,它可能会接连查询根DNS服务器、顶级域(TLD)服务器,然后到达负责该域名的权威DNS服务器。这一系列查找过程的效率直接影响到用户访问速度。

当提到DNS解析时,一些常见的问题不容忽视。首先是DNS缓存的有效性。试想一下,若本地DNS缓存过期或错误,可能会导致网站无法访问或访问缓慢。为了解决这一问题,定期监控和清理DNS缓存显得尤为重要。DNS配置错误也是常见的陷阱。无论是域名过期、CNAME记录错误,还是其他配置失误,都可能导致解析失败。建议管理员定期检查DNS设置,确保所有记录的正确性和有效性。

当前,随着网络的迅猛发展,DNS性能的提升也备受关注。一些新兴技术,如DNS over HTTPS(DoH)和DNS over TLS(DoT),提供了更安全的名称解析方案,增强了用户隐私保护。在选用DNS服务时,不仅要考虑解析速度,也要关注这些安全特性,保障用户信息不被泄露。

在DIY组装和优化DNS环境的过程中,有几个实用的技巧值得分享。使用本地DNS解析服务,比如Unbound或dnsmasq,可以显著提升访问速度并降低延迟。配置前向解析和反向解析能提高域名管理的灵活性。对于企业用户来说,依赖多DNS服务提供商也能够保证在某些服务故障时,能够快速切换,降低业务影响。

随着市场对网络安全和解析速度的不断追求,了解并解决DNS解析过程中的常见问题,显得尤为重要。这不仅对个人用户有帮助,对企业的网络运营也至关重要。以下是一些常见问题解答,帮助用户更好地理解DNS解析原理:

1. 什么是DNS缓存,如何清除?

- DNS缓存是存储在用户设备或本地DNS服务器上的域名解析记录。清除缓存通常可以通过操作系统的命令提示符或终端完成,例如在Windows中使用`ipconfig /flushdns`。

2. DNS解析慢的原因有哪些?

- 可能的原因包括DNS服务器距离用户位置较远、服务器负载过重、DNS记录过期或配置错误等。

3. 如何选择安全的DNS服务?

- 选择知名的DNS服务提供商(如Google DNS、Cloudflare DNS等),并优先考虑支持DNS over HTTPS或DNS over TLS的服务。

4. 当DNS查询失败时,应该如何排查?

- 检查网络连接,确保DNS服务器设置正确,使用`nslookup`或`dig`工具进行手动查询以确定故障点。

5. DNS重绑定攻击是什么?如何防范?

- DNS重绑定攻击是指攻击者利用DNS解析漏洞,将用户访问的域名指向恶意服务器。采取使用CSP(内容安全政策)和限制域名访问权限的措施可以有效防范该类攻击。

掌握DNS解析的基本原理,了解潜在问题并采取优化措施,无疑能为网络访问体验带来显著提升。希望本篇文章能为您在DNS相关的学习和实践中提供支持和帮助。